Two Trains Running is the centerpiece production of the Goodman’s March/April 2015 citywide August Wilson Celebration curated by Chuck Smith with Constanza Romero, Ron OJ Parson and Dr. Harvey Young. In 2007, Goodman Theatre became the first theater in the world to produce all 10 plays in August Wilson’s “20th Century Cycle,” of which Two Trains Running is a part (the Goodman previously produced this play in 1993, directed by Lloyd Richards). The civil rights movement is sweeping across Pittsburgh’s Hill District in 1969, but the promise of a better tomorrow hasn’t quite reached all of the city’s residents, some of whom gather daily at Memphis’ diner to gossip about the neighborhood, dream about their futures and confront the brutal realities of the present. Now Memphis must decide if he should allow the government to take over his building or sell the property to a ruthless businessman. In one of his most affecting plays, written in 1990, the legendary Wilson explores a time of extraordinary change—and the ordinary people who get left behind.
